/* 查询 */
.ywdx{text-transform:uppercase;}
.chaxun{ background: url(/Mobile/Zhengscx/images/cx_1.jpg) center no-repeat; background-size: cover;}
.chaxunxz{ background: #eee; padding: 20px;}
.chaxunxz p{ font-size: 14px; color: #999; margin-bottom: 5px;}
.chaxunxz select{ background: #fff url(/Mobile/Zhengscx/images/cx_19.jpg) right 10px center no-repeat; background-size: 20px; line-height: 40px; width: 100%; padding-left: 20px; padding-right: 40px;}
.chaxuntitle{margin: 0 auto; text-align: center; line-height: 60px;}
.chaxuntitle a{ display: inline-block; padding: 0 30px; background: rgba(255,255,255,0.1); font-size: 16px; color: #fff; border-radius: 10px 10px 0 0; cursor:pointer; }
.none{ display: none;}
.chaxuntitle a.dangqian{ background: #fff; color: #2e2e2e;}
.chaxunnr{ margin: 0 auto; background: #fff; padding:10px; overflow: hidden;}
.chaxunnrleft{ padding: 20px 10px; border: 1px solid #ddd;}
.chaxunnrlefttitle{ text-align: center; background: url(/Mobile/Zhengscx/images/cx_2.jpg) left center repeat-x; text-align: center;}
.chaxunnrlefttitlebox{ display: inline-block; background: #fff; padding: 0 10px;}
.chaxunnrlefttitlebox span{ float: left; font-size: 36px; color: #1c6fcf; display: block; padding-right: 10px;}
.chaxunnrlefttitlebox .text{ overflow: hidden; line-height: 30px;}
.chaxunnrlefttitlebox .text_1{ font-size: 16px; color: #1c6fcf; margin: 0; text-align: center;white-space: nowrap; text-align: left;}
.chaxunnrlefttitlebox .text_2{ font-size: 12px; color: #929292; text-align: center;white-space: nowrap; text-align: left;}
.chaxunnrleftnr p{ padding-left: 30px; background: url(/Mobile/Zhengscx/images/cx_3.jpg) left center no-repeat; margin-top: 20px;}
.chaxunnrleftnr .text_2{background-image: url(/Mobile/Zhengscx/images/cx_4.jpg);}
.chaxunnrleftnr .text_3{background-image: url(/Mobile/Zhengscx/images/cx_5.jpg);}
.chaxunnrleftnr p input{ line-height: 32px; height: 32px; padding: 0; border-radius: 5px; padding-left: 4%; width: 96%; border: 1px solid #95b8e7;}
.chaxunnrleftnr .text_4{ font-size: 12px; color: #9a9a9a; background: none; margin-top: 10px;}
.chaxunnrleftnr .text_5{ background: none; padding-left: 0;}
.chaxunnrleftnr .text_5 button{ width: 80%; background: #ffb400; border: 0; width: 80%; margin: 0 auto; display: block; line-height: 36px; color: #fff; font-size: 16px; border-radius: 5px;}
.chaxunnrright{ overflow: hidden; margin-top: 20px;}
.chaxunnrright .text_1{ font-size: 16px; color: #303030; border-bottom: 1px solid #e0e0e0; margin-bottom: 10px; padding-bottom: 15px; padding-left: 20px; position: relative;}
.chaxunnrright .text_1::after{ content: ""; display: block; width: 4px; height: 20px; background: #1c6fcf; border-radius: 20px; position: absolute; left:0; top: 1px;}
.chaxunnrright img{ width: 100%;}

.cxinfobanner{ background: url(/Mobile/Zhengscx/images/cx_1.jpg) center no-repeat; background-size: cover;}
.cxinfobannerbox{ width: 1200px; margin: 0 auto; padding-top: 65px;}
.cxinfobannerbox p{ margin-left: 20px; background: #fff;  display: inline-block; line-height: 40px; padding: 0 30px; border-radius: 10px 10px 0 0; font-size: 14px; color: #2e2e2e;}

.cxinfonr{ background: #f8f9fa; border: 5px solid #dee2e6;margin: 20px 10px; position: relative; z-index: 1;}
.cxinfonr::after{ content: ""; display: block; width:30px; height: 30px; position: absolute; left:0; top: 0; background: url(/Mobile/Zhengscx/images/cx_12.jpg) center no-repeat; background-size: contain; z-index: -1;}
.cxinfonr::before{ content: ""; display: block; width: 30px; height: 30px; position: absolute; right:0; top: 0; background: url(/Mobile/Zhengscx/images/cx_13.jpg) center no-repeat; background-size: contain; z-index: -1;}
.cxinfonrbox{ padding: 20px; position: relative; z-index: 1;}
.cxinfonrbox::after{ content: ""; display: block; width: 30px; height: 30px; position: absolute; left:0; bottom: 0; background: url(/Mobile/Zhengscx/images/cx_15.jpg) center no-repeat; background-size: contain; z-index: -1;}
.cxinfonrbox::before{ content: ""; display: block; width: 30px; height: 30px; position: absolute; right:0; bottom: 0; background: url(/Mobile/Zhengscx/images/cx_14.jpg) center no-repeat; background-size: contain; z-index: -1;}
.cxinfonrtitle{padding-bottom: 10px; border-bottom: 1px solid #e0e0e0;}
.cxinfonrtitle span{ font-size: 16px; color: #303030; font-weight: bold; position: relative; padding-left: 10px;}
.cxinfonrtitle span::after{ content:""; display: block; width: 4px; height: 17px; background: #1c6fcf; border-radius: 5px; position: absolute; left:0; top:2px;}
.cxinfonrtitle i{ font-size: 14px; color: #8f8f8f; margin-left: 10px;}
.cxinfonr1{ overflow: hidden; margin-top: 10px; margin-bottom: 10px;}
.cxinfonr1 .img{ float: left; margin-right: 10px;}
.cxinfonr1 .img img{width: 90px; height: 140px; border: 4px solid #dee2e6;}
.cxinfonr1 .text{ font-size: 16px; color: #303030; line-height: 20px; overflow: hidden;}
.cxinfonr1 .text p{ border-bottom: 1px dashed #dfe0e1; padding: 5px 0;}
.cxinfonr2{ overflow: hidden; border: 1px solid #e0e0e0; border-top: none;}
.cxinfonr2 p{ width: 96%; float: left; font-size: 14px; color: #303030; line-height: 34px;  border-bottom: 1px dashed #dfe0e1; padding: 5px 2%;}
.cxinfonr3{ border: 5px solid #dee2e6; margin: 0 10px 10px; padding:20px;}
.cxinfonr3box{ margin-top: 10px;}
.cxinfonr3box .img{ background: #ebebeb; text-align: center;}
.cxinfonr3box img{ width: 173px; height: 113px;}
.cxinfonr3box .text{ margin-top: 10px; font-size: 14px; color: #8f8f8f; line-height: 40px; overflow: hidden;}















